The world:
- National Day of Dominica. Independence Day (1978);
- National Day of Micronesia. Independence Day (1986).
On this date in Bulgarian history:
1907: Labour Inspectorate instituted by law.
1970: Chemical Works open in Vidin.
1977: Magnitude-5.3 quake strikes near Velingrad.
1988: Eighty intellectuals set up Informal Club Supporting Glasnost and Perestroika in Sofia.
1989: Ecoglasnost activists stage first civic demonstration against totalitarian regime, hand petition signed by 12,000 people to Parliament against two hydropower projects.
1996: Petar Stoyanov and Todor Kavaldzhiev of United Democratic Forces are elected President and Vice President in second round of voting.
2008: Bulgarian scientists Stoil Zahariev, Ivan Kasamakov and Roumen Kakanakov from Plovdiv's Central Laboratory of Applied Physics invent and patent device using UV light-emitting diodes for water purification (up to 500 ml).
